/*
 * Client setup for the Marrowby report builder export API.
 * Sorting note: the builder's comparator is NOT stable across
 * shards — ties on the sort column can reorder between runs.
 * Always append `row_uid` as a final tiebreaker before comparing
 * exports, or your diffs will be noise. Do not "fix" ordering
 * client-side; the Fenwick team owns the comparator. This client
 * talks to the internal export gateway and authenticates with
 * the staging key below.
 */

gateway credential: kto23_dolYgAScEh2TaPOlStqOl98

This release of the Tidegate relay addresses the websocket reconnect bug in which clients re-authenticated with a stale session token after a dropped connection, briefly bypassing the revocation check. The fix forces a full handshake on every reconnect and bounds retry backoff so a flapping client cannot hammer the auth tier. We have kept the mitigation behind explicit settings so reviewers can audit each knob independently. For the security assessment, please verify the deployment manifest pins the following configuration values.

service settings:
[casax]
port = 6379
team = rusir
host = casax.zemvarhq.corp
region = outer-4
access_code = ac_9808ce
timeout_ms = 1500

Internal Memo — Retirement of the Corvid Line

To the finance team: the Corvid product line will be retired at fiscal year-end. Please ensure remaining inventory is written down on the agreed schedule, supplier commitments are closed out, and warranty reserves are maintained for eighteen months. Departmental cost codes will be archived after the final reconciliation. The confidential planning note is set out below.

confidential, kagap-kajeg: Istethax Holdings is in early talks to buy Ulaielix Works for about $23.7 million. The Lamys launch date is July 6, and nothing goes to the press before then.